Join Amazon's AMXL team as a Supply Chain Manager supporting middle mile long-term planning. You will play a key role in shaping network strategy across the 1-5 year horizon, working with cross-functional teams to optimize transportation cost, carrier mix, and capacity planning for Amazon's extra large item delivery network. This role offers direct exposure to senior leadership and the opportunity to influence decisions that impact millions of customer deliveries.

  • Key job responsibilities
  • Support middle mile network strategy and execution planning for the 1-5 year horizon
  • Configure and analyze optimization models to assess network scenarios and produce strategy recommendations
  • Coordinate planning cycle inputs across Retail, Finance, Operations, and Science teams
  • Analyze transportation cost drivers including carrier mix, attainment, and sort center connectivity
  • Build and maintain full year plans for middle mile operations across US and Canada
  • Support development of strategic planning documents for leadership review
  • Identify opportunities to reduce cost-to-serve and improve network efficiency

A day in the life
Your primary focus is building and analyzing long-term transportation plans for the AMXL network. You'll spend your time running scenarios through optimization tools, digging into the data to understand what's driving costs, and working with partners across finance, operations, and science to make sure the plans reflect reality. During busier periods, you'll help pull together the inputs and analysis that go into strategy documents for senior leaders. Outside of those cycles, you'll have time to dig into specific problems — like how carrier mix impacts cost, or where the network has capacity gaps — and bring recommendations to the team.

About the team
Amazon Extra Large (AMXL) is a single-threaded organization with ownership of the end-to-end customer experience for large, heavy, and bulky products. AMXL consolidates E2E supply chain: strategy, data analytics, tech, operations, warehousing, order fulfillment, transportation, and delivery. The AMXL NA Middle Mile Long Term Planning team drives network strategy and capacity planning across sort centers, carrier partnerships, and delivery connectivity for the 1-5 year horizon.
